Find your perfect shade with a Dulux colour tester – this Pressed petal paint sample has a matt finish and is suitable for interior walls and ceilings.
- Surface Preparation - Ensure the area to be painted is clean and any loose paint is removed
- Instructions for Use - Apply using the built-in mini roller
Features and benefits
- Mess-free application with the built-in mini roller
- Water-based emulsion
- We want you to be satisfied with your colour selection. Not all monitors will display colours the same and paint tins may not show the same colour as your walls do in natural light. We therefore recommend you order a tester pot online or pop in store to pick one up so you are sure that this is the right colour for you
- Dulux one coat has been specifically formulated to easily give you the perfect finish in just one coat. The built-in mini roller applies the paint to the wall just like a decorating roller, so you can see exactly how the colour will look before you start painting.

PainterDecorator 35 years exp First if there was a paint that covered in one coat then painters would be very wealthy . May cover over mid grey light beige but def not over white or dark colours in one coat .
